The effects of ultraviolet communication in different working wavelength base on single-scatter model

The effects of different wave band and the visibility on non-line-of-sigbt (NLOS) ultraviolet (UV) communication are introduced based on single-scatter model. Besides, the choices of the asymmetry factor and phase function are discussed. At last, the proportion of Rayleigh scattering part to Mie scattering part on different working angle and different H-G phase function is discussed. The results show that the longer the wavelength, the more beneficial to UV communication. On different working mode, the smaller the scattering angle, the more favorable to transmission. The selection of H-G phase function in the UV transmission has its limitations.
